Matt Arsenault ec6175c524 AMDGPU: Partially fix implicit.buffer.ptr intrinsic handling
This should not be treated as a different version of
private_segment_buffer. These are distinct things with
different uses and register classes, and requires the
function argument info to have more context about the
function's type and environment.

Also add missing test coverage for the intrinsic, and
emit an error for HSA. This also encovers that the intrinsic
is broken unless there happen to be stack objects.

; RUN: llc -mtriple=amdgcn-mesa-mesa3d -verify-machineinstrs < %s | FileCheck -check-prefix=GCN %s
; FIXME: Requires stack object to not assert
; GCN-LABEL: {{^}}test_ps:
; GCN: s_load_dwordx2 s[4:5], s[0:1], 0x0
; GCN: buffer_store_dword v0, off, s[4:7], s2 offset:4
; GCN: s_load_dword s{{[0-9]+}}, s[0:1], 0x0
; GCN-NEXT: s_waitcnt
; GCN-NEXT: ; return
define amdgpu_ps i32 @test_ps() #1 {
%alloca = alloca i32
store volatile i32 0, i32* %alloca
%implicit_buffer_ptr = call i8 addrspace(2)* @llvm.amdgcn.implicit.buffer.ptr()
%buffer_ptr = bitcast i8 addrspace(2)* %implicit_buffer_ptr to i32 addrspace(2)*
%value = load volatile i32, i32 addrspace(2)* %buffer_ptr
ret i32 %value
}
; GCN-LABEL: {{^}}test_cs:
; GCN: s_mov_b64 s[4:5], s[0:1]
; GCN: buffer_store_dword v{{[0-9]+}}, off, s[4:7], s2 offset:4
; GCN: s_load_dword s0, s[0:1], 0x0
define amdgpu_cs i32 @test_cs() #1 {
%alloca = alloca i32
store volatile i32 0, i32* %alloca
%implicit_buffer_ptr = call i8 addrspace(2)* @llvm.amdgcn.implicit.buffer.ptr()
%buffer_ptr = bitcast i8 addrspace(2)* %implicit_buffer_ptr to i32 addrspace(2)*
%value = load volatile i32, i32 addrspace(2)* %buffer_ptr
ret i32 %value
}
declare i8 addrspace(2)* @llvm.amdgcn.implicit.buffer.ptr() #0
attributes #0 = { nounwind readnone speculatable }
attributes #1 = { nounwind }
